统计大量数据用什么编程语言

worktile 其他 86

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    统计大量数据是一个重要而庞大的任务,选择合适的编程语言可以提高效率和准确性。以下是几种常用的编程语言,可以用于统计大量数据。

    1. Python
      Python是一种广泛使用的编程语言,特别适合数据处理和分析任务。它提供了许多强大的库和工具,例如NumPy、Pandas和SciPy,可以处理大规模的数据集。此外,Python还有众多的统计和机器学习库,如Scikit-learn和TensorFlow,可以进行高级的数据分析和建模。

    2. R
      R是一种专门用于统计分析和数据可视化的编程语言。它拥有丰富的统计库和包,如ggplot2和dplyr,可以直接处理并分析大规模的数据集。R也支持高级的统计技术和机器学习算法,是许多数据科学家和统计学家首选的语言。

    3. SQL
      SQL是结构化查询语言,主要用于数据库管理和查询。当大量数据存储在关系型数据库中时,SQL可以通过使用SELECT语句和聚合函数来执行统计操作。它具有强大的查询能力和优化技术,适用于处理大规模的数据。

    4. Scala
      Scala是一种功能强大的编程语言,它融合了面向对象编程和函数式编程的特性。Scala可以与Apache Spark等大数据处理框架结合使用,处理海量的数据集。由于其并行处理和集群计算能力,Scala被广泛应用于大规模数据统计和分析。

    根据具体的需求和项目要求,选择合适的编程语言是统计大量数据的关键。除了上述提到的编程语言外,还有其他一些语言和工具,例如Julia和Hadoop等,可以根据具体情况进行选择。最重要的是熟悉和掌握所选语言的特性和相关的统计工具,以最大限度地提高数据统计的效率和准确性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    统计大量数据通常使用的编程语言有多种选择,以下是其中几种常见的编程语言:

    1. Python:Python是一种功能强大且易于学习的编程语言,它提供了许多用于数据处理和分析的库和工具,如NumPy、Pandas和Matplotlib。Python在统计建模、数据清洗和可视化方面表现出色,其简洁而易读的语法使得处理大量数据变得更加高效。

    2. R:R是一种专门用于统计分析和数据可视化的编程语言。它拥有一系列丰富的统计包,如ggplot2和dplyr,适用于数据挖掘、机器学习和预测建模等领域。R具有强大的数据处理和可视化能力,使得它成为统计学家和数据科学家的首选工具之一。

    3. SQL:SQL是用于管理和操作关系型数据库的标准化查询语言。对于需要进行大规模数据处理和数据分析的任务,结构化查询语言(SQL)是一种非常有效的选择。通过编写SQL查询,可以对数据进行筛选、排序、聚合和连接等操作,从而对大型数据集进行统计分析和数据探索。

    4. Java:Java是一种通用性较强的编程语言,也被广泛用于大数据处理。通过使用Java的Hadoop和Spark等框架,可以实现分布式计算和大规模数据处理。Java有一套强大的库和工具,为统计分析和数据挖掘提供了支持。此外,Java的多线程和并发处理能力也使得它适用于处理复杂的数据分析任务。

    5. Scala:Scala是一种与Java兼容的静态类型编程语言,广泛用于处理大量数据和大规模分布式计算任务。在Spark等大数据处理框架中,Scala作为主要的编程语言,既能够提供与Java相似的性能,又具备函数式编程的特性,使得程序员能够更高效地编写复杂的数据操作和分析任务。

    这些编程语言各有自己的特点和优势,选择适合的编程语言取决于具体的需求和个人的技术偏好。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    统计大量数据可以使用多种编程语言。以下是使用一些常用编程语言进行数据统计的方法和操作流程的简要介绍。

    1. Python
      Python是一种流行的编程语言,非常适合处理数据统计任务。它具有简洁的语法和丰富的数据处理库,如NumPy、Pandas和Matplotlib。

    使用Python进行数据统计的步骤如下:
    (1) 导入所需的库:例如,使用import numpy as np导入NumPy库,使用import pandas as pd导入Pandas库等。
    (2) 读取数据:使用Pandas库提供的函数从文件或数据库中读取数据,例如使用pd.read_csv()读取CSV文件。
    (3) 数据清洗和处理:使用Pandas库提供的函数执行数据清洗和处理操作,例如删除空值、过滤数据等。
    (4) 进行数据分析:使用NumPy和Pandas库提供的函数进行数据分析和计算,例如计算平均值、中位数、方差等。
    (5) 可视化数据:使用Matplotlib库提供的函数绘制数据图表,例如折线图、柱状图、饼图等。

    1. R
      R是一种专门用于统计分析和数据可视化的编程语言。它具有强大的统计分析功能和丰富的数据处理和可视化库。

    使用R进行数据统计的步骤如下:
    (1) 安装和加载所需的包:例如,使用install.packages("dplyr")安装dplyr包,使用library(dplyr)加载dplyr包等。
    (2) 读取数据:使用R提供的函数从文件或数据库中读取数据,例如使用read.csv()读取CSV文件。
    (3) 数据清洗和处理:使用dplyr包提供的函数执行数据清洗和处理操作,例如删除空值、过滤数据等。
    (4) 进行数据分析:使用R提供的函数进行数据分析和计算,例如计算平均值、中位数、方差等。
    (5) 可视化数据:使用ggplot2包提供的函数绘制数据图表,例如折线图、柱状图、散点图等。

    1. SQL
      SQL(Structured Query Language)是用于管理和处理关系型数据库的语言。它提供了许多功能强大的查询和聚合函数,适用于大规模数据的统计分析。

    使用SQL进行数据统计的步骤如下:
    (1) 连接到数据库:使用数据库管理系统提供的命令或工具连接到数据库服务器。
    (2) 选择数据表:使用SQL的SELECT语句选择要进行统计的数据表。
    (3) 进行数据聚合:使用SQL的聚合函数(如SUM、COUNT、AVG等)对数据进行聚合计算。
    (4) 进行数据筛选和排序:使用SQL的WHERE和ORDER BY语句对数据进行筛选和排序。
    (5) 进行数据分组和统计:使用SQL的GROUP BY语句对数据进行分组和统计,例如按照某个字段分组计算平均值、总和等。
    (6) 可选的数据可视化:将SQL查询结果导出到其他工具进行可视化,如Excel、Tableau等。

    除了以上提到的编程语言,还有其他一些编程语言也可以用于数据统计,如MATLAB、Julia等。选择适合自己需求的编程语言,在进行大量数据统计时能够提高效率和准确性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部